Unique Middle Names for Boys Named Clay

If you have named your son Clay and are looking for a unique and meaningful middle name, we have some great suggestions for you. These names will not only complement Clay but also add character and depth to his full name.

1. Clay Evander: Evander means “good man” and is of Greek origin. This name exudes strength and virtue, making it a powerful choice for a middle name.

2. Clay Orion: Orion is a constellation in the night sky and is associated with great power and charm. This name will add a touch of celestial wonder to your son’s name.

3. Clay Felix: Felix means “happy” or “fortunate” in Latin. This name will bring a sense of joy and positivity to your son’s name.

4. Clay Atlas: Atlas was a Greek titan who held up the celestial sphere. This name is strong and enduring, perfect for a middle name that carries weight.

5. Clay Everett: Everett is of English origin and means “brave boar.” It is a strong and rugged name that will add a sense of adventure to your son’s name.

6. Clay Theodore: Theodore means “gift of God” and is a classic name with a timeless appeal. It symbolizes wisdom and strength, making it an excellent choice for a middle name.

7. Clay Asher: Asher means “fortunate” or “blessed” in Hebrew. This name will bring a sense of positivity and prosperity to your son’s name.

8. Clay Sebastian: Sebastian is of Greek origin and means “venerable” or “revered.” This name adds a touch of elegance and sophistication to your son’s name.

9. Clay Knox: Knox is of Scottish origin and means “round hill.” It is a strong and masculine name that will add a sense of ruggedness and resilience to your son’s name.

10. Clay Phoenix: Phoenix is a mythical bird that rises from the ashes, symbolizing rebirth and renewal. This name will add a sense of mystique and resilience to your son’s name.

These unique middle names are sure to make your son’s name stand out and capture attention. Choose the one that resonates with you and your family the most, and give your son a name that is truly special.

Middle Names with Literary References for Clay

Choosing a middle name for your child is an opportunity to add a touch of literary style and substance to their name. If you’re considering the name Clay, here are some unique and meaningful middle names with literary references that you might like to explore:

1. Clay Atticus: Inspired by the character Atticus Finch from Harper Lee’s novel “To Kill a Mockingbird.” Atticus is known for his strong moral compass and devotion to justice.

2. Clay Sebastian: Drawing from the character Sebastian Flyte in Evelyn Waugh’s novel “Brideshead Revisited.” Sebastian is a complex character known for his charm and self-destructive tendencies.

3. Clay Dorian: Inspired by the character Dorian Gray from Oscar Wilde’s novel “The Picture of Dorian Gray.” Dorian is a fascinating character who becomes obsessed with eternal youth and beauty.

4. Clay Holden: Drawing from the character Holden Caulfield in J.D. Salinger’s novel “The Catcher in the Rye.” Holden is a rebellious and introspective teenager who navigates the complexities of adulthood.

5. Clay Hermione: Inspired by the character Hermione Granger from J.K. Rowling’s “Harry Potter” series. Hermione is known for her intelligence, bravery, and loyalty.

6. Clay Santiago: Drawing from the character Santiago in Ernest Hemingway’s novel “The Old Man and the Sea.” Santiago is a resilient and determined fisherman who embarks on a grueling battle with a marlin.

7. Clay Ophelia: Inspired by the character Ophelia in William Shakespeare’s play “Hamlet.” Ophelia is a tragic figure known for her innocence, beauty, and descent into madness.

8. Clay Arwen: Drawing from the character Arwen Undómiel in J.R.R. Tolkien’s “The Lord of the Rings” series. Arwen is a powerful elf princess with a deep love for the human Aragorn.
